ysql中,刪除一個字段需要使用ALTER TABLE語句,具體步驟如下:
1. 首先,使用DESCRIBE語句查詢當前表的結構,確認需要刪除的字段名稱和屬性;
2. 使用ALTER TABLE語句,將需要刪除的字段從表中刪除。語法如下:
amename;
amename是需要刪除的字段名稱。
3. 執行上述ALTER TABLE語句后,將會刪除指定的字段。需要注意的是,刪除一個字段將會刪除該字段在表中的所有數據,因此在刪除字段之前需要備份數據。
tsame、age和address四個字段。現在需要刪除address字段,具體步驟如下:
1. 使用DESCRIBE語句查詢表結構:
可以看到表結構如下:
+-------+--------------+------+-----+---------+----------------+
Field | Type | Null | Key | Default | Extra
+-------+--------------+------+-----+---------+----------------+
tcrement
ame | varchar(20) | YES | | NULL
t(11) | YES | | NULL
address | varchar(50) | YES | | NULL
+-------+--------------+------+-----+---------+----------------+
set (0.00 sec)
可以看到,需要刪除的字段是address。
2. 使用ALTER TABLE語句刪除address字段:
ts DROP COLUMN address;
ts表中刪除。
需要注意的是,在刪除字段之前需要備份數據,以免數據丟失。同時,刪除字段可能會影響表的性能,因此需要謹慎操作。